The complaint was having to notice the metadata was missing, then go
and hunt the album down on the Autotag page. The album page now says it
while you are looking at the thing: "MusicBrainz has a match for this
album: <release> by <artist>", with Apply tags and Review in Autotag.

Four things about it are load-bearing.

**Applying is offered only where it would do the whole album.** A
tagging group is a folder, so a multi-disc album is several, and one
button that applied to the best-scoring group would leave the album
holding a mix of old and new tags — the exact case the app's Blocking
notification level exists for. `groupCount` is the test, and the answer
there is review rather than apply.

**It rewrites files, so it asks.** `confirmAction()` with an impact
line that says it cannot be undone and that nothing is moved or
deleted, because "rewrites your files" reads worse than it is. The
apply goes through `ApplyAsync`, the registered-job path, so progress
belongs to the jobs indicator and this page does not grow a second one
— what it owes the user is the acknowledgement, because the button is
here. The suggestion clears itself on success rather than inviting a
second click while the job runs.

**The banner does not quote a percentage.** The backend has a score and
deliberately keeps it out of the sentence: 0.95 reads as a probability
and is not one. Which release it is, is the part a person can judge.

**"Review in Autotag" lands on that album.** The queue is sorted by
score so the intended folder is often near the top, and "often" is a
link that sometimes opens a different album. Autotag is a cached
primary view, so there is no construction to hand a payload to: the
request goes on as an attribute and the view *consumes* it, or every
later visit would reopen a folder the user finished with long ago.

`ICON_AUTOTAG` joins the vocabulary at the same time, on the rule
`ICON_PLAYLIST` was chosen by — an icon names the noun it acts on, so a
suggestion pointing at Autotag wears the Autotag destination's own
mark. It was written inline in the sidebar; two call sites is where a
name stops being one component's detail, so the sweep governs it now.

Verified against the running app with a staged match: the banner, the
confirm dialog's wording, and the navigation landing on the right
folder with the attribute consumed.
